We have had such a positive start at Wivenhoe Kitchen and can’t thank you all enough.

We’ve been trading for six weeks now and we’re getting into a good routine. The system of asking people to pre-order by Thursday has proved very effective as has offering a range of frozen meals that are for sale on Saturday. We update the social media sites with a list of what’s available from the freezer on Friday evenings and then it’s first come, first served.


We are regularly selling out of some dishes, the pea pastizzis in particular! Here’s a picture of some giant ones!


But back to the main reason for this update; obviously, England is returning to lockdown restrictions from Thursday this week. It is our intention to continue trading while maintaining safe social distancing and following all that is required of us to keep our customers and ourselves safe. We are able to offer a free delivery service to anyone who lives in Wivenhoe. Just let us know if this is a service that you would like and we will add your order to our Saturday boy’s delivery list! If you prefer to stay at home and would like to know what frozen meals we have available, again, just get in touch (phone, e mail, social media etc) and we will do our best to provide you with the meals you would like.

We will still be happy to greet you (from a safe social distance) at the unit on Saturday mornings when we are open from 9-1. There will be hand sanitizer available outside the kitchen and we will pass your order out to you. We now have a bank card reader for contactless payments but will continue to accept cash too.
